Introduction

The Highfield Level 4 award course is designed to allow the learner to understand the importance of how to develop, implement and evaluate CODEX based HACCP food safety management procedures.

Who Should Attend?

This course is aimed at learners who are working at management level within food manufacturing and catering environments, quality assurance staff or members of the HACCP team.  This qualification would also be useful for trainers, auditors, enforcers and other food safety professionals.

Prior Knowledge

There are no prerequisites for this qualification, although it is recommended that learners already hold a Level 4 Award in Food Safety qualification and/or a Level 3 HACCP qualification or before undertaking this qualification. Consultation between the learner and trainer may be required to ensure that the level of microbiology knowledge and other food safety matters is sufficient to undertake this qualification.

It is also recommended that learners have a minimum of Level 2 in literacy/English or equivalent.

Course Objectives

The objective of the qualification is to give delegates the skills to lead in the development and implementation of a HACCP system, to critically evaluate HACCP plans and to understand the importance of having an effective HACCP system in place.

Course Content

  • HACCP and Legislation
  • Preparing for HACCP
  • Pre-requisite Programmes
  • The 7 Codex HACCP Principles
  • HACCP Documentation
  • Critical Control Points
  • Critical Limits
  • Monitoring
  • Corrective Action
  • Maintaining HACCP
  • The HACCP Team
  • Hazard Analysis
  • Implementation
  • Verification
  • Validation
  • Review

What are the benefits?

On successful completion, delegates will have a good awareness of HACCP legislation and principles and will understand:

  • The Importance of HACCP based food safety management procedures
  • How to manage the implementation of HACCP based food safety management procedures
  • How to develop and evaluate HACCP based food safety management procedures
